May 3, 2019 Florida Moves to Withhold Voting Rights for Felons Until All Old Fines Are Paid ------------------------------------------------------------------------------- The Florida Senate has passed a bill that would require former felons to repay all financial obligations before their voting rights are restored. This comes six months after voters in Florida approved a measure to restore voting rights to 1.4 million people with nonviolent felonies who have fully completed their sentences. One in five African Americans in Florida and 10 percent of the state's adult population have been ineligible to vote because of a criminal record. .
